第二章函数编程的核心概念
本章介绍
■了解概念和基础
■不可变数据编程
■函数式代码的推论
■函数式值和数据类型
如果你问三个函数程序员,什么是函数范式最基本的方面,很可能有三个不同的答案。原因是函数编程已经存在很长时间了,各种不同的编程语言应用范围很广泛;每种语言强调的重点不同,但对于其他的语言来说,可能并不重要;但其中的大部分概念在所有的函数式语言中都有所表现。
本章...
分类:
其他好文 时间:
2014-08-12 10:25:53
阅读次数:
170
变量类型 ????一般我们总是会把编程语言按照各种纬度做很多归类,比如根据是解释执行还是编译执行的划分车成两类。另一个划分纬度就是变量是弱类型还是强类型的,所以可见变量类型在一门语言是多么的重要。 ...
分类:
其他好文 时间:
2014-08-12 09:07:04
阅读次数:
191
大家好,我是一名热爱编程的视障者,编程之路可谓是坎坷不平埃编程语言我学了一大圈,也学了好几年,但是都没坚持下去,一直处于闭门造车的局面。C语言我坚持了好久也做不出一点东西,对我的信心打击真的很大,但是我仍然没有选择离开。我初期学编程的木的就是能为视障者写一些..
分类:
其他好文 时间:
2014-08-12 03:31:54
阅读次数:
142
变量
变量可用来存储程序中使用的值。要声明变量,必须将 var 语句和变量名结合使用。在 ActionScript 2.0 中,只有当您使用类
型注释时,才需要使用 var 语句。在 ActionScript 3.0 中,总是需要使用 var 语句。例如,下面的 ActionScript 行声明一个名
为 i 的变量:
var i;...
分类:
其他好文 时间:
2014-08-12 00:48:43
阅读次数:
225
JS理论:1、JavaScript是一个客户端脚本 ------工作在客户端的浏览器完成;相对应的PHP、ASP.NET 、JSP 是一个服务端脚本。2、JS可以插入到HTML中的任意一个位置,不过HTML解析式从上往下解析的,所以放在上面可能会找不到控件。3、JS的特点:脚本编程语言基于对象的语言...
分类:
Web程序 时间:
2014-08-12 00:05:03
阅读次数:
341
类图描述的是类之间的静态关系,而序列图展示的是对象之间的沟通方法,描述运行时的交互关系。
OOP编程语言里面合理的直接交互方式只有一种,方法调用(Event通讯是间接的)。所以序列图也可以
理解为方法调用交互图。方法调用有四个元素,参与者(两个,调用者和被调用者),方法名称,输入
和输出。
参与者
参与者用一个Lifeline来表示,图像为一个矩形外加底部的一条竖线。矩形里面显示对象名,...
分类:
其他好文 时间:
2014-08-11 21:36:32
阅读次数:
409
不知不觉已经使用java工作三年了,工作中乱七八糟的用到的学到的都从来没有整理过,曾经看过一篇文章,上面说由于java简单易用,所以现在催生了一大批低端程序员,他们只知其然不知其所以然,能熟练的使用java等一些编程语言但也仅此而已,就算工作了十年进步仍旧不大,跟刚从..
分类:
编程语言 时间:
2014-08-11 18:09:43
阅读次数:
173
win32程序是利用编程语言直接调用windows api编写的程序,可以在任何装有正确windows的机器上运行,程序员发挥的空间也最大,能实现在该操作系统中可以编程实现的任何功能。 而.net的窗体应用程序是一种托管代码,无论你是用c++\c#还是vb编写,只能在.net环境中应用,就是说你编译...
C#是面向组件的语言编程语言趋势:自包含自描述垃圾回收异常处理类型安全C#继承与c++与Java的糅合版本控制virtual override.cs作为扩展名命名空间程序类型成员程序集程序集的扩展名一般为.dll(library)或者.exe(application)。主要看其中是否包含main入口...
分类:
其他好文 时间:
2014-08-11 11:37:42
阅读次数:
325
??单例模式算是设计模式中比较简单的一种吧,设计模式不是只针对某种编程语言,在C++, Java, PHP等其他OOP语言也有设计模式,笔者初接触设计模式是通过《漫谈设计模式》了解的。这本书中是用java写的,个人感觉拜读完这本书以后虽然有不理解的地方但还是收获蛮大的。上面提到依赖注入,控制翻转.....
分类:
其他好文 时间:
2014-08-11 09:53:01
阅读次数:
244